WebIt needs two electrons to make it stable as 8 electrons in its valence shells. This makes oxygen a O −2 anion. Ionic bond form when the charges between the metal cation and non-metal anion are equal and opposite. This means that two Li +2 cations will balance with one O −2 anions. The ionic formula for Lithium Oxide is Li 2O. WebIonic compounds are neutral compounds made up of positively charged ions called cations and negatively charged ions called anions. For binary ionic compounds (ionic compounds that contain only two types of elements), the compounds are named by writing the name of the cation first followed by the name of the anion. Web1.3.1 Ionic Bonds To explain how ionic bonds form, we will use common table salt, NaCl, as an example. Sodium has an atomic number of 11; hence, sodium has one electron in its outer electron shell. Chlorine, on the other hand, has an atomic number of 17 and has seven electrons in its outer shell.
